The 2108 was designed to provide a test tool that can be easily programmed to emulate a wide range of serial buses in automated test applications. A second goal was to provide the design engineer with an interactive tool for development of a new serial bus, or modification of a standard serial bus. These goals were accomplished in the Model 2108.

The 2108 is preprogrammed with standard encoding and formatting schemes which allow the user to quickly emulate the most common serial buses. For modified or custom interfaces, programming is accomplished through an interactive software development package which can be mastered in minutes. For those with extremely complex tasks, the 2108 provides programming to the "bit" level using "micro code".

Each transmit/receive module is coupled to the front panel via a UUT interconnect module. The interconnect modules are software selectable to support multiple signal types. Custom interconnect modules can be quickly and easily developed to meet user’s requirements.

Modular Design

The Model 2108 is a register based VXI module which provides for the fastest possible communication between the unit and the VXI controller. This allows data to be transferred in a continuous mode if required.

The Model 2108 baseboard houses 1-4 serial channels and associated UUT I/O interconnect modules. Each channel may be a transmitter or receiver and is addressed as an independent instrument. Adjacent transmitters and receivers may be operated as a bi-directional bus.

2108 Project Development Software

The Model 2108 is shipped with VXIPlug&Play Win95,98 & NT compatible drivers. Included with the Model 2108 is an additional software package titled the 2108 Project Development Software. This graphical software provides the user a means to program set-up instructions, download and upload data and interactively execute test routines. The test files generated may be saved for downloading and executing by the Plug&Play drivers using any standard Windows based test program. In addition, the software is excellent as a design tool for simulating new designs of custom or modified buses in the development lab.

2108TX Transmitter

The 2108TX Transmitter features data rates from 5Kbps to 200Mbps using internal or external clocks. It has software selectable data formats for the most used NRZ, Biphase or AMI formats. In addition users may program the 2108TX to inject errors, parity, or PRBS data. The two 4 Mbit memories may be used in a ping-pong operation to continually output data while reloading new data from the VXI controller.

Transmitter Interconnect Modules

The Transmitter Interconnect Modules provide the user with drivers to meet the electrical requirements of the UUT. Variable voltage drivers may be programmed to meet a wide range of signal levels from ECL to +/- 15V in 20mV increments. In addition, drivers may be programmed as bi-polar, differential or trinary. Custom modules are available to meet user’s requirements if off-the-shelf modules do not meet user’s requirements.

2108RX Receiver

The 2108RX Receiver records data at rates from 5Kbps to 200Mbps using internal or external clocks. It features clock recovery logic to sync to external clocks or data. Data capture or transmission may be initiated using 16 levels of 32bit trigger patterns. The trigger compare logic provides for operations such as command/response or pre & post data capture based on the received data. The VXI controller may continually offload recorded data using the two 4Mbit memories in a ping-pong operation.

Receiver Interconnect Modules

The Receiver Interconnect Modules provide for the physical connection to the UUT. The voltage detection range may be set as high as –15V to +15V with standard modules. Signal types may be programmed as bi-polar or differential. Software selectable impedance is provided. Data rates to 200Mbps are supported. Custom modules will be provided in those cases where standard modules do not meet user’s requirements.
